Understanding Public Records in Kerrville, TX

Public records, including arrest records, are maintained by government agencies and are, with some exceptions, available for public inspection. This transparency is a cornerstone of a democratic society, allowing citizens to stay informed about the activities of law enforcement and the judicial system. In Kerrville, TX, these records are typically managed by the Kerr County Sheriff's Office, the Kerrville Police Department, and the Kerr County District Clerk's Office. Each entity plays a crucial role in documenting and disseminating information about arrests, court proceedings, and other legal matters. The accessibility of these records ensures accountability and provides a means for the public to monitor the actions of those in power. Additionally, the availability of public records facilitates various legal and administrative processes, such as background checks, legal research, and journalistic investigations. However, it's important to note that not all records are created equal, and some information may be redacted or sealed to protect privacy or maintain the integrity of ongoing investigations. Understanding the nuances of public records laws and how to navigate the different agencies is essential for anyone seeking information about individuals who have been arrested or involved in legal proceedings in Kerrville, TX.

Where to Find Kerrville Arrest Records

Okay, so you're curious about Kerrville, TX busted newspaper. Where do you actually look? Here are a few key places:

  • Kerr County Sheriff's Office: This is your go-to spot for recent arrests and law enforcement activities. They usually have an online portal or a physical records department.
  • Kerrville Police Department: Similar to the Sheriff's Office, the local PD keeps records of arrests made within the city limits. Check their website or visit them in person.
  • Kerr County District Clerk's Office: This office handles court records, so you can find information on court cases related to arrests. They're usually located at the county courthouse.
  • Online Databases: There are also third-party websites that compile arrest records from various sources. Be cautious with these, as they may not always be accurate or up-to-date. Always double-check with official sources.

Navigating Online Resources for Arrest Information

Online resources can be incredibly helpful when searching for arrest information in Kerrville, TX. However, it's essential to approach these platforms with a critical eye and a clear understanding of their limitations. Official government websites, such as the Kerr County Sheriff's Office and the Kerrville Police Department, are generally the most reliable sources for accurate and up-to-date information. These websites often provide online portals or search tools that allow you to access arrest records, inmate rosters, and other relevant data. When using these resources, be sure to verify the information with other official sources, especially if you plan to use it for legal or administrative purposes. Additionally, it's important to be aware of any disclaimers or limitations on the use of the information provided.

Third-party websites that compile arrest records from various sources can be convenient, but they may not always be accurate or complete. These websites often rely on automated data scraping and may not have the resources to verify the information they collect. As a result, it's crucial to exercise caution when using these platforms and to cross-reference any information you find with official sources. Additionally, be wary of websites that charge excessive fees for access to public records or that make unrealistic promises about the accuracy or completeness of their data.
